What Has Been The Evolution of the Bacterial And Plasmid Vectors Market in Recent Years?

The bacterial and plasmid vectors market has seen considerable growth due to a variety of factors.
• The dimension of the bacterial & plasmid vectors market has experienced accelerated development in the last few years. It's projected to expand from $0.72 billion in 2024 to $0.82 billion in 2025, boasting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 13.0%.
The notable growth that occurred historically is accredited to factors such as the increasing instances of chronic and infectious diseases, a growing elderly population, higher healthcare expenses, government initiatives, and a heightened awareness about preventive healthcare.

What Is the Forecasted Market Size and Growth Rate for The Bacterial And Plasmid Vectors Market By 2029?

The bacterial and plasmid vectors market is expected to maintain its strong growth trajectory in upcoming years.
• In the coming years, the market size for bacterial & plasmid vectors is predicted to experience significant acceleration. The value of the market is projected to reach $1.31 billion by 2029, expanding at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 12.4%.
Growing demand in diverse areas such as point-of-care testing, gene and cell therapy, synthetic biology, CRISPR-Cas technology, enhanced bioproduction, environmental and agricultural applications, biomanufacturing expansion, and personalized medicine contribute to this forecasted growth. Key trends for the forecast period comprise bespoke vector solutions, considerations of safety and ethics, progressive vector delivery methods, data amalgamation and analysis, alternatives to viral vectors, vector customization services, and optimization of vector delivery.

What Are The Leading Drivers Of Growth In The Bacterial And Plasmid Vectors Market?

The projected rise in cancer and infectious diseases is expected to enhance the demand for bacterial and plasmid vectors in the upcoming years. These vectors are harnessed to transport recombinant proteins into host cells to address various ailments like cancer and diverse infectious diseases. Bacterial and plasmid vectors play a crucial role in research related to cancer and infectious diseases, delivering therapeutic genes, vaccines, or genetic material. These elements can either trigger immune reactions or rectify genetic anomalies, thereby preventing, managing or treating these diseases by tackling their root causes or bolstering the body's protective mechanisms. For instance, the American Cancer Society, a non-profit organization in the US, reported in April 2024 that around 609,000 deaths were due to cancer and a predicted 1.9 million new cancer instances were identified in the US in 2022. An upward trend in mortality rates is expected in 2024 with an estimated 620,000 cancer-related deaths. Consequently, the growing prevalence of cancer and different infectious diseases coupled with the escalating need for bacterial and plasmid vectors for gene therapy are predicted to fuel revenue growth in the bacterial and plasmid vectors market.

What Emerging Trends Are Influencing The Growth Of The Bacterial And Plasmid Vectors Market?

Prominent players in the bacterial and plasmid vectors market are concentrating on pioneering progressive solutions like Adeno-Associated Viral Vector. This effort aims to augment gene therapy applications and fulfill the increasing need for efficacious therapeutic alternatives. An Adeno-Associated Viral (AAV) Vector is a variant of virus-based vector utilized in gene therapy for genetic material transportation into cells. As an illustration, Charles River Laboratories, a chemical manufacturing firm based in India, launched a ready-made helper plasmid in March 2023. This product boasts unique characteristics such as immediate and dependable availability, a consistently suitable quality, kanamycin antibiotic resistance, production without animal components, and a license and royalty-free usage from research to the commercial phase. These traits assist in hastening the production cycles for AAV-based gene therapies and streamlining convoluted supply chains in the manufacturing operation.
